How Reliable is the Peugeot 107?

Based on 2,229,410 MOT tests across 139,779 vehicles.

76.8%
Pass Rate
4,290
Miles/Year
21
Year Lifespan
139,779
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 42,280
Wind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ively 15,841
Registration plate lamp not working 15,772
Brake pad(s) less than 1.5 mm thick 14,213
